How we worship is more important than where we worship. 

The woman at the well said, "Our fathers worshipped in this mountain; and ye say, that in Jerusalem is the place where men ought to worship."  Jesus responds by telling her that one day they will not worship in either place, telling her that it is not about the place that you worship but it's about the quality of your worship.
